The equipment you need to paddleboard

There are a few essential pieces of equipment you need to paddle board. First, you need a paddleboard. You can either rent one or buy one.

Second, you’ll need a life jacket or another flotation device. This is for your safety in case you fall off your paddleboard. If you’re starting, we recommend renting one to see if you like it before investing.

Third, you’ll need a leash that attaches your paddleboard to your ankle. This keeps you tethered to your board, so you don’t lose it if you fall off. Fourth, we recommend wearing sunscreen and a hat to protect yourself from the sun’s harmful rays.

Finally, if you’re paddling in an area with waves, you may want to wear a wet suit or dry suit to keep yourself warm and dry.

Is paddle boarding safe for nonswimmers?

Paddleboarding is an inherently safe activity if participants take the necessary safety precautions.

Nonswimmers can enjoy paddle boarding, but they should know a few things before getting started. First and foremost, nonswimmers should always wear a life jacket while paddle boarding.

Additionally, it is essential to choose a calm body of water to paddle board in – avoid areas with strong currents or waves. Finally, it is always a good idea to have a friend or family member nearby in emergencies.

With these safety measures in place, nonswimmers can confidently enjoy paddle boarding!

What should you not do when paddle boarding?

When you are first starting, there are a few things you should avoid doing on your paddle board.

Here are a few things to keep in mind:

  • Don’t stand up too quickly. Take your time getting used to the feel of the board before you try to stand up.
  • Don’t lean too far forward or back. It would be best to keep your center of gravity balanced so you don’t fall off.
  • Don’t paddle too close to other people or objects. You want to give yourself plenty of room to maneuver.
  • Don’t forget to wear sunscreen! The sun can be intense when you’re out on the water.

Is paddle boarding tiring?

Paddle boarding is a great workout, but it can be tiring. Here are a few tips to help you stay energized while paddle boarding:

  • Drink plenty of water before, during, and after your paddle-boarding session.
  • Eat a healthy snack or meal before you head out on the water.
  • Take breaks as needed, especially if you start to feel tired.
  • Paddle at a comfortable pace and don’t try to push yourself too hard.

With these tips in mind, you should be able to enjoy a fun and energizing paddle-boarding experience!
